Not Sure About Your Fit? – Check to Ensure:

Your Vehicle has Detachable Headrests

Your Front Seats are not attached to the mid console

Your Front Seats do not have integrated (attached to the seat itself) Seat Belts

Measurements:

Front Bucket Seat (Bottom): 23″ W x 18″ L

Front Bucket Seat (Top): 24″ W x 22″ L

Rear Bench Seat (Bottom): 56″ W x 23.5″ L

Rear Bench Seat (Top): 56″ W x 30″ L

You can view the diagram in the pictures to the left for clarification on measurements.

They were great for just covering my seats until I get really … They were great for just covering my seats until I get really nice seat covers, but you get what you pay for… They’re thin and cheap and one of the little elastic bands snapped off but it’s still staying on the seat. I have a Chevy Sonic and the bench seat cover doesn’t really fit at all. It’s bunched up and I had to modify it to fit the clasps that hold the seats upright. Overall, if you just want something to go over your seats, this will do. The floor mats are really nice, worth most of…

  2. Great for the price. I bought these for my 2008 Nissan Xterra and was really happy with them. After reading the reviews, I gave myself a few hours to get the car seats put together. The two bucket seats were simple. The back wasn’t difficult either but I did grab a few rubber bands to help me hold everything together. I was a female putting the seats together without help and it just took time and patience. Looks much nicer than it did before and I can still put the back seat down to the trunk if I need. I’d…
